I am Unique Horn
I am Unique Horn, a Dutch singer-songwriter based in Athens, creating emotive, synth-pop driven music that sometimes also touches some elements of EDM.
My music lives at the intersection of emotion, identity, and self-discovery. My work is rooted in honest lyricism, exploring the full spectrum of feeling—from the quiet ache of heartbreak to the warmth of connection, and the ongoing process of becoming.
I’m drawn to softness and space in sound. Through subtle electronic textures and a restrained yet expressive vocal approach, I try to create music that doesn’t demand attention, but gently invites it. For me, vulnerability isn’t something to hide—it’s the foundation of everything I make.
My current project 'Hurting, Loving & Becoming' is deeply personal. It unfolds in 3 chapters, each representing a different emotional and creative phase of my life.
Rather than separate releases, I see my music as one continuous journey—shifting, evolving, and reflecting where I am at a given moment. Each chapter holds its own perspective, but together they form a larger story.
My identity as a queer artist is present in everything I do, but not as a fixed definition. I experience identity as something fluid, something that changes and reveals itself over time. That sense of in-betweenness and exploration shapes both my sound and my storytelling, and I hope it creates space for others who feel the same.

I want my music to feel close—like something shared rather than performed. Some songs are more outgoing, where others are more stripped back. With my music I am trying to create an atmosphere where emotion can exist without distraction.
At its core, my music is about connection. It’s for those who feel deeply, who move through love and loss in their own way, and who are searching for something honest to hold onto. I’m not trying to give answers—just to create a space where feeling is allowed, and where being in-between is enough.
